KEY TIP

Changes to Office applications (and Windows) is slow, "evolutionary" rather than "revolutionary". So when you find resources that look good, do not ignore them simply because they are not for your specific version of Office.  Older tips, going back to menu versions are often still very applicable to 2016.  The command locations may vary, but the underlying logic still applies, with only a little translation.
